Born in Australia to Italian parents, Bonacci's professional background is as fascinating as his esoteric studies. A Melbourne-based flamenco, Latin, and jazz guitarist, his artistic life might seem at odds with his role as a "Universal Truth Scholar". However, for Bonacci, the universal, eternal concepts of astrology and theology are sciences that harmonize man with his natural surroundings.
